I'm new to the whole M42 but have gotten hands dirty getting to know the car.  I bought the car knowing that there was coolant in the oil thinking it was just a head gasket.  

Well I've torn the engine apart and sure enough the headgasket was pretty much missing right above the water pump.  It is such an easy engine to work on I loved every minute of it.  To bad when I took everything apart the lower intake manifold had three of the four inlets coated in 1/4 inch of black dirt/oil/burnt mixture.

Anyways,  looks like I have a completely torn apart M42 and looking for any suggestions on what to do since its taken apart.  I already have plans to bring the block and head into a shop and have them look at it.  I'll post pics next weekend when I drive back to where I'm storing it. I don't think it would have made the 300 mile drive from minneapolis to appleton.  Do M42's have a problem with the headgasket?

Sounds like you have a case of a profile gasket having gone bad. How many miles on the car? The heads warp easily on these cars so have it checked out (hopefully the owner didn't drive it with the issue too long) as you indicated and you should be good to go.
